petr0v Извините за опоздание в ответе. Ваш вопрос весьма конкретный, надо мне было проблему продумать.
Если Вас устраивает дробное значение Fs/FB = 6,66..., то тем более должно Вас устраивать целое Fs/FB = 7 или Fs/FB = 8 на выходе вашего передискретизатора перед дециматором с шагом D по схеме с Рис. 2. При входном Fs/FB = 10/3 и выходном Fs/FB = 8 (т.е. для L = 8/(10/3) = 12/5 = 2,4) эта схема (с дополнительной 8-кратной децимацией) принимает конкретный вид:
Здесь 1/40-полосный интерполирующий фильтр, рассчитанный н.п. по формулам (19)-(21) со
второй части, очень длинный, но при фиксированной задержке d перед дециматором с шагом 40, на входную последовательность с Fs/FB = 1 фактически работает единственно одна ветвь полифазной (40-фазной) его структуры (FIR в 40 раз короче).
В 2-скоростном упрощенном варианте, до входа 8-кратного компрессора по схеме с Рис. 1 и формуле (3) схема с 3,33...-кратной децимацией принимает следующий вид:
Здесь интерполирующий фильтр (40/8 = 5 раз короче) тоже можем декомпозировать на 8 ветвей его полифазной структуры и, при известной задержке d, оставить одну ветвь - ту, которая вырабатывает выходную последовательность, которой Fs/FB = 1.
Как видите ваш вопрос, хотя выходит он за рамки моей статьи, даётся вмонтировать в её суть. Использование предложенной здесь второй схемы (вместо вашей, с использованием одной ветви 2-фазной структуры 1/2-полосного фильтра), по-моему, сбережения вычислительных затрат не принесёт, но улучшения качества передискретизации с 3,33... Sa/symbol на 1 Sa/symbol следует ожидать.